Dumfries & Galloway Hard of Hearing Group

Do you need help with your NHS hearing aid?

The Hard of Hearing Group is a local charity who have trained volunteers that provide help and support with the following:

  • Tubing, minor repairs, ear mould cleaning and battery replacement
  • Advice on how to clean your hearing aids and how to get the most out of your hearing aids
  • Information and signposting to other services
  • Introduction to other useful equipment

Why not come along to your local Stranraer drop in?

From the 14th of September 2016, the drop in will be held here at the Building Healthy Communities offices at Innistaigh, Dalrymple Street, Stranraer every 2nd and 4th Wednesday of the month from 10am - 12noon

The Living Well - Community Services in Dumfries and Galloway. A Search Tool.

Please take time to read this post and search the directory of activities as developed by the Third Sector Dumfries and Galloway

We are moving towards a health and social care landscape that will see greater emphasis on personal resilience and looking beyond the clinical environment for solutions to health problems that are often socially determined. There is a wealth of community resources on our doorstep that could help people better manage their health, but often they remain unknown to us.

As a result, Third Sector, Dumfries and Galloway has developed a new service, designed to promote better health and wellbeing throughout the region, but also pull together all useful activities and services into one place. Funded as part of its Adult Health and Social Care project, ‘The Living Well’ provides an online directory for health, social and community services that is bespoke to Dumfries & Galloway. Its aim is to help improve access to information for the general public and health and social care professionals, ensuring everyone can have access to the services which will improve their lives or the lives of those they support.

Users can freely search for activities and services from a topic of their choosing - either from their local area or regionwide.

To search the directory click HERE or go to the Third Sector logo on the right of the page.

The Living Well is open for submissions from any groups or services which benefit an individual’s health and wellbeing. Its overall aim is to be the central point where organisations big and small are able to promote their services to the widest possible audience.
